Barbaresco from Prunotto is crafted from selected Nebbiolo vineyards in Piedmont and captures the character of this noble grape. The bouquet reveals red berries, dried roses, licorice and gentle spice. On the palate the wine is full-bodied yet refined, with ripe fruit, hints of leather and tobacco and a well-judged line of acidity. Firm but silky tannins provide structure and length. The finish lingers with forest fruits, savoury spice and a touch of truffle. This is a classic partner for slow-cooked meat dishes, lamb, mature cheese or traditional Piedmontese cuisine with truffles.

Across the hills of Barbaresco, Prunotto carries more than a century of Piedmont heritage. Founded in 1904 as the co-operative “Ai Vini delle Langhe”, the winery took on its modern identity in the 1920s under Alfredo Prunotto, who gave the name a global voice. In 1956 he handed the reins to oenologist Beppe Colla, an early pioneer of single-vineyard bottlings that helped define the Langhe’s cru mindset....
